Default early bmw motronic yrs 82 to 87

there's no checksum for any of them. And here's a thought. wanna measure more air flow? Just put two identical AFM's in parallel. Don't even have to hook them together electrially to the ecu. Just need equal split of air flow. So one unit will be measuring exactly one half of total. Now instead of x air flow at say, 3v, you got 2x air flow at 3v, but only 1x of fuel delivery. What to do? Adjust the injector constant so it
gives 2x of fuel delivery. Ya adjust agin for thos bigger injectors. Not a perfect idea but it a basic fuel system anyway. But looks to be a low buck way to get 400hp of air flow measurment instead of 200hp. What the heeeck. Noone has to do it.
